There are common words you can say to yourself over and over that mimic the rhythm of various time signatures. If I remember correctly, for 3/4 time, it's "pineapple". If you imagine a waltz (or actually waltz...why not!) saying to yourself "pineapple, pineapple, pineapple...", you'll get the idea. Mute the strings on your guitar and just strum to mimic the rhythm, emphasizing the one beat..."PINE-a-pple, PINE-a-pple, PINE-a-pple...".

If you do this with evenly spaced up and down strokes, it may feel weird because of 3 being an odd number. If you strum up and down consistently, the first time around the ONE beat is a down strum, next time around it is on an upstrum...

D-u-d-U-d-u-D-u-d-U-d-u...

Using a down strum for the ONE and up strums for the two and three beats my feel more natural...

D-u-u-D-u-u-D-u-u-D-u-u
